Rabindra Kr Pathak


 

 

Mr. Rabindra Kr. Pathak did his LL.M. from Indian Law Institute with a Gold Medal in Jurisprudence, after completing LL.B. from Campus Law Centre, Delhi University. He qualified for NET-JRF in 2011. He is currently pursuing his doctoral research on “Constitutional Adjudication” from Burdwan University. He has authored two books, and has published around twenty research papers, articles and book review in national and international journals and law reviews of repute like Bond Law Review, Asian Journal of International Law, Journal of the Indian Law Institute, Indian Bar Review, Indian Human Rights Law Review, Madras Law Journal, to name a few. He has also contributed three book chapters to edited books, and has recently co-edited a book, Rethinking Law (2012). He has worked as a Legal Researcher for a project assigned by Rajya Sabha (2008), and also for a project on Centre-State Relations for Indian Law Institute (2009). Previously, he was a Guest Lecturer at Indian Law Institute, New Delhi (2009 & 2011). His areas of interest are Jurisprudence, Constitutional Law and Human Rights. He is currently working on “Law and Indian Cinema”, and also on Preamble to the Constitution of India.
